Visiting Karakol Nature Park «Uch Enmek». During the excursion we will get acquainted with different kinds of traditional dwellings of indigenous Altai people, as well as with the basics of their material and spiritual culture.

On the way we will stop at the confluence of the Chuya and Katun rivers (only in winter these rivers can be seen in such color!).

Not far away we will see petroglyphs «Kalbak-tash». This unique archeological monument of the Altai Republic was a sacred place for the peoples living here at different times. Now the complex counts about 5 thousand rock drawings of different epochs.

In the morning visiting Red Gates. Passing along the narrow ribbon of road through the Chibitka River, it is impossible not to stop at the picturesque place – huge steep rocks of red color rise 50 meters into the heights, thanks to volcanic rocks, which contain an admixture of mercury minerals.

The next stop is near Geyser Lake – the «earth's eye» of unique turquoise color. From time to time «geysers» come to life, throwing to the surface a mixture of bluish clay and sand, forming numerous circles on the bottom of the lake.

Departure to Kyzyl Chin valley (Altai Mars), where unreal Martian landscapes painted with an amazing palette of colors are waiting for us. The local rock contains mercury in large quantities and this gives a reddish color to the surrounding rocks.

How to get there

There are several ways to get from Moscow to the starting point of the tour:
the most convenient way is by airplane to Gorno-Altaisk (about 4,5 hours from Moscow: Aeroflot, Pobeda, S7 and other airlines).

You can also get there:
– by flight to Barnaul (4 hours from Moscow, Aeroflot, S7 Airlines and others);
– by train to Barnaul (2,5 days from Moscow);
– by flight to Novosibirsk (3,5 hours from Moscow, Aeroflot, S7 Airlines and others);
– by train to Novosibirsk (2 days from Moscow)
Flight tickets to Novosibirsk are often cheaper than to Barnaul, but transfer from Novosibirsk takes longer.

Flights from Moscow to Barnaul or Gorno-Altaisk usually depart in the evening and land the next morning. Flights from Barnaul depart to Moscow in the morning and land in Moscow the same morning. There are day flights from Moscow to Novosibirsk, which are convenient to arrive at the time of the tour start. There are evening and morning flights from Novosibirsk to Moscow.
